1. Introduction to Cryptocurrencies
Cryptocurrencies, digital or virtual currencies that use cryptography for security, have gained significant attention in recent years. These digital assets are created and managed through advanced cryptographic techniques, ensuring secure transactions and control the creation of new units. The most well-known cryptocurrency is Bitcoin, which was introduced in 2009.

3. Benefits of Cryptocurrency for Global Transactions
One of the primary advantages of cryptocurrencies is their ability to facilitate fast, secure, and cost-effective cross-border transactions. Cryptocurrencies operate on decentralized networks, which means they are not controlled by any central authority, such as a government or bank. This decentralization leads to lower transaction fees and faster transaction times compared to traditional banking systems.
Moreover, cryptocurrencies can help reduce the risk of fraud and counterfeiting, as every transaction is recorded on a public ledger called a blockchain. This immutable record ensures that the ownership of digital assets can be easily verified.

5. Current Global Cryptocurrency Adoption Rates
The adoption rate of cryptocurrencies varies significantly across different regions and countries. Some countries, like El Salvador, have embraced Bitcoin as a legal tender, while others have strict regulations against cryptocurrencies. The global adoption rate is still relatively low, but it is growing steadily.

7. Technological Barriers to Cryptocurrency Adoption
Technological barriers, such as scalability issues, energy consumption, and security concerns, pose significant challenges to the widespread adoption of cryptocurrencies. Scalability issues, such as Bitcoin's limited transaction capacity, can lead to high transaction fees and network congestion. Additionally, the high energy consumption of some cryptocurrencies, such as Bitcoin, has raised environmental concerns.

4. Q: What are the potential environmental impacts of widespread cryptocurrency adoption?
A: The potential environmental impacts of widespread cryptocurrency adoption include increased energy consumption and greenhouse gas emissions. This is primarily due to the energy-intensive process of mining some cryptocurrencies, such as Bitcoin.
5. Q: How can scalability issues be addressed in the cryptocurrency ecosystem?
A: Scalability issues can be addressed by implementing layer-2 solutions, improving the consensus mechanism, or adopting alternative blockchain technologies that offer higher transaction throughput and lower latency.

7. Q: Can cryptocurrencies be used for illegal activities, and how can they be regulated to prevent this?
A: Cryptocurrencies can be used for illegal activities, but they can also be regulated to prevent this. Governments and regulatory bodies can implement measures such as know-your-customer (KYC) requirements, transaction monitoring, and the use of blockchain analytics to track and trace suspicious activities.
